I've noticed that the definition of \ifpassthroughchars is duplicated.
Here is the patch for fix it.

ChangeLog:

Remove duplicated definition of \ifpassthroughchars

2016-03-XX  Masamichi Hosoda  <address@hidden>

        * doc/texinfo.tex (\ifpassthroughchars):
        Remove duplicated definition.
--- texinfo.tex.org     2016-03-08 22:46:15.850782600 +0900
+++ texinfo.tex 2016-03-14 22:34:30.708418900 +0900
@@ -10865,9 +10865,6 @@
   \unicodechardefs
 }
 
-\newif\ifpassthroughchars
-\passthroughcharsfalse
-
 % For native Unicode (XeTeX and LuaTeX)
 % Definition macro to replace / pass-through the Unicode character
 %
